Top 5 Vikings Games on Android in the UK Q4 2023

In the fourth quarter of 2023, the top 5 Vikings-themed games on Android in the United Kingdom experienced varying trends in downloads, revenue, and weekly active users. Data for these insights comes from Sensor Tower, providing a comprehensive overview of each game's performance.

Viking Rise: Valhalla by IGG.COM saw its revenue fluctuate throughout the quarter, peaking at around $22K in late October and again in late December. Downloads showed a steady upward trend in October, reaching approximately 4.7K by the end of the month. Weekly active users increased from 27K at the beginning of the quarter to 29K by the end of December, indicating a growing user base.

Vikings: War of Clans from Plarium LLC experienced a notable increase in revenue towards the end of the quarter, peaking at about $23K in late December. Downloads were relatively low but saw a slight peak of 761 in late October. Weekly active users remained relatively stable, with a slight increase from 2.7K at the start of the quarter to 3.1K in mid-October before stabilizing around 2.6K towards the end of December.

Vikingard published by Exptional Global had a consistent revenue flow, with a peak of approximately $5.9K in late October. Downloads were modest, peaking at 316 in late November. The game’s weekly active users showed a slight decline from 1.9K in late September to around 1.5K by the end of December.

Lucky Buddies by Everybuddy Games displayed a steady revenue trend, peaking at around $3.4K in mid-October. Although there were no significant downloads recorded after mid-October, the game maintained a stable number of weekly active users, starting at 428 and ending at 271 by the close of the quarter.

Frostborn: Action RPG from KEFIR showed a significant increase in revenue towards the end of the quarter, reaching approximately $1.5K in mid-December. Downloads also saw a peak of 262 in late December. The game’s weekly active users increased from 173 at the start of the quarter to 341 by the end, reflecting a growing engagement.
